METHOD AND APPARATUS FOR CACHING VARIABLE LENGTH INSTRUCTIONS
An instruction cache controller uses supplemental memory to store a redundant copy of cached instruction data corresponding to a cache boundary position, and thereby enables subsequent single cache access retrieval of an instruction that crosses that boundary position. In one or more embodiments, th...
Saved in:
Main Author | |
---|---|
Format | Patent |
Language | English French German |
Published |
18.07.2018
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| An instruction cache controller uses supplemental memory to store a redundant copy of cached instruction data corresponding to a cache boundary position, and thereby enables subsequent single cache access retrieval of an instruction that crosses that boundary position. In one or more embodiments, the cache controller duplicates instruction data for the post-boundary position in the supplemental memory, and multiplexes that copied data into cache data obtained from the pre-boundary position. |
---|---|
Bibliography: | Application Number: EP20070760923 |